Jaguars 18 Eagles 24, NFL London 2018: Super Bowl champions thrill record Wembley crowd as Carson Wentz stars

Carson Wentz threw for three touchdowns as the Super Bowl champions, the Philadelphia Eagles won the final game of this season’s NFL London series.

The Eagles beat London regulars the Jacksonville Jaguars 24-18 in front of a crowd of 85,870 at Wembley, the most ever for a UK NFL game.

The Jaguars’ preparation was marred when it emerged that four players had been arrested in the early hours of Sunday morning after allegedly attempting to leave a nightclub without paying the bill.

On the field though, they started well, and took the lead through Josh Lambo’s 51-yard field goal, before Jalen Ramsey came up with a touchdown-saving interception in the endzone.

The Eagles levelled with the boot of Jake Elliot before a monster 67-yarder from Lambo restored the Jacksonville lead.

Right on half-time the Eagles took their first lead, with Wentz finding tight-end Dallas Goedert on a 32-yard touchdown play.

The Eagles then extended their lead midway through the third quarter, as Wendell Smallwood ran in from 32 yards to cap off a drive that had begun almost on their own goal line.

Under-fire quarterback Blake Bortles then threw for his first touchdown of the afternoon, finding Dede Westbrook, who did brilliantly to stay in bounds at the back of the endzone.

Myles Jack then came up with a huge sack on Wentz, before Westbrook’s punt return moved the Jags straight back into Eagles territory as the momentum swung Jacksonville’s way.

Lambo then reduced the gap to just two points, making it 17-15, with a 33-yard field goal at the start of the fourth quarter.

The Eagles had blown a 17-0 lead in the fourth against the Carolina Panthers last weekend, but when Wentz found Zach Ertz from five yards for a touchdown with ten minutes to play, a repeat looked unlikely.

Another Lambo field goal made it 24-18, but it should really have been closer, with DJ Clark juggling and then dropping a Bortles pass in the endzone.

The defeat leaves the Jaguars at 3-5 at the season’s midway point, with a mountain to climb to retain their divisional title and reach the playoff.

The Eagles meanwhile move to a level 4-4 in defence of their Super Bowl.
